Test Frame JBS–16
Product code: 0775039
Technical Documentation
JBS–16 is used when the service work must be done without covers in the phone. The
phone’s radio module is placed into plastic frame, which provides the needed connections to the bottom– and battery connectors of the phone. RF connection is done by
RF cable, which is as well included into the JBS–16.
Suitable d.c. power supply regulation for JBS–16 concept is provided by example
JBS–7. Note, that the UI module (flexi) is not required in this environment. Note also,
that some of the signal values give wrong results when RF shields are removed. Hence
the phone should never be tuned without shields.

Service Box JBS–7
Product code: 0770015
Service Tools / Accessories
Service box provides convenient test environment (regulated power supply, M2BUS,
preset battery reference voltage, external RF connection, audio test loops, HOOK
switch etc) and mechanical interface in one box.
When AUDIO switch of JBS–7 is INT position, the AF signals are routed normally to the
modular–type system connectors. When in EXT position, the AF signals are routed
from the speaker pin of the bottom connector straight back to the external microphone
pin of the phone. Thus the speech codec of the phone is able to feed the internally generated test signal to the loudspeaker line, and measure the same signal from the EXT
MIC line. Whenever audio signals are to be monitored or measured outside the phone,
the AUDIO switch of the JBS–7 must be in INT position.
When HOOK switch is in OFF position and the phone in cellular mode, the audios are
always routed to ear–piece and internal microphone.
Additionally JBS–7 has a spare battery slot, through which the battery may be connected to external capacity meter.

Flash Prommer FPS–3C
Product code: 0770110
Technical Documentation
FLASH prommer is used to update the main software of the phone, should that some
day become necessary . Updating is done by first loading the new MCU software from
PC to the FLASH prommer and then loading the new SW from prommer to the phone.
When updating more than one phone in a row , the new MCU SW must be loaded to the
prommer only in the beginning.
Service software (called also PC Locals) is used to control the functions of the phone
with IBM compatible PC/486 or higher or compatible personal computer during the service work. PC and PC Locals are maybe the most important service tools nowadays.
